Clinical Overview

A Beta Hydroxy Acid (BHA) that exfoliates skin, dissolves pore-clogging sebum, and helps treat acne. A keratoplastic agent that sheds dead skin cells from the scalp, reducing dandruff, scale build-up, and itching. An antipsoriatic agent that slows down the excessive growth of skin cells in plaque psoriasis.

Usage Guidelines

Use in facewash or apply lotion/cream to affected areas once or twice daily. Massage into wet hair/scalp, leave for several minutes, then rinse. Use 2-3 times a week. Apply strictly to psoriasis plaques for short periods (10-30 minutes), then wash off thoroughly.

General Guidance: Clean and dry the affected area completely before applying any topical cream, gel, or lotion. Unless specified, apply a thin layer and rub in gently. Always wash hands before and after application.

Possible Side Effects

Mild peeling, dryness, and temporary skin irritation. Staining of skin/hair, sun sensitivity, and skin irritation. Skin irritation, staining of skin, nails, and clothes.

*Note: Side effects vary from person to person. Not everyone experiences them. If side effects persist, worsen, or if you develop an allergic reaction (swelling, hives, breathing difficulties), contact a healthcare professional immediately.

Precautions & Warnings

Do not use on open wounds. Discontinue if severe irritation occurs. Use sun protection. Increases susceptibility to sunburn; avoid sun exposure for 24 hours after application. Do not apply on face, skin folds, or normal skin. Wash hands thoroughly.
